Lexus RX OBD-II Port Location
The 16-pin diagnostic connector is located Driver footwell above brake pedal assembly. Plug in your scan tool to verify freeze-frame sensor values.

3. Step-by-Step DIY Repair Guide for Lexus RX

01
Scan and Record Freeze Frame Telemetry

Connect an OBD-II scan tool and record freeze frame sensor telemetry for code P0092 to note engine RPM, load, and voltage when the fault triggered. on the Lexus RX equipped with 2.4L Turbo (RX 350 275HP) / 2.5L Hybrid / 2.4L Turbo Performance Hybrid (RX 500h 366HP).

Required Tool: OBD-II Scanner
02
Inspect Related Wiring Harness & Connectors

Inspect the electrical connector and wiring harness related to P0092 for chafing, corrosion, moisture, or pin push-out. on the Lexus RX equipped with 2.4L Turbo (RX 350 275HP) / 2.5L Hybrid / 2.4L Turbo Performance Hybrid (RX 500h 366HP).

Required Tool: Flashlight, Multimeter
03
Test Component Resistance & Voltage Supply

Measure circuit voltage supply (12V B+ or 5V reference) and sensor/actuator resistance according to factory repair manual specifications. on the Lexus RX equipped with 2.4L Turbo (RX 350 275HP) / 2.5L Hybrid / 2.4L Turbo Performance Hybrid (RX 500h 366HP).

Required Tool: Digital Multimeter
04
Replace Defective Component

Install a new OEM-grade replacement part, torque fasteners to factory spec, and ensure electrical locking tabs click firmly. on the Lexus RX equipped with 2.4L Turbo (RX 350 275HP) / 2.5L Hybrid / 2.4L Turbo Performance Hybrid (RX 500h 366HP).

Required Tool: Hand Tool Socket Set, Torque Wrench
05
Clear Trouble Codes & Complete Drive Cycle

Clear all stored DTCs from vehicle memory and perform an OBD-II drive cycle to confirm the diagnostic monitor resets to 'Ready'. on the Lexus RX equipped with 2.4L Turbo (RX 350 275HP) / 2.5L Hybrid / 2.4L Turbo Performance Hybrid (RX 500h 366HP).

Required Tool: OBD-II Scanner
